> 24 hourThis is definitely a nice upgrade to the included tampers with Breville machines. It has a nice weight and solid feel to it. Definitely sturdy, but does not have precision tolerances. To be fair, it isnt advertised as being a precision tamper, but just know that you will need to be make sure that you are tamping evenly. There is still enough room between the tamper and the wall of the portafilter basket for the tamper to come down at an angle and create an uneven bed. Overall, still not a bad value, just be aware of what youre getting for the money.
